A little more ABOUT ME…

I am a Registered Clinical Counsellor and an Approved Clinical Supervisor (RCC-ACS) with the BC Association of Clinical Counsellors. I have over 20 years of experience providing clinical assessment and treatment as well as psychotherapy in a variety of therapeutic contexts, with folks of diverse identities and backgrounds.

Much of my clinical experience comes from working hospitals and community psychiatric clinics, though also with non-profit agencies and in schools. In contrast, for the past few years, I have been running my own private practice. I offer services for folks of all ages, including children and youth and provide individual, couples and family counselling.

A significant percentage of my therapeutic practice is dedicated to trauma work, including responding to crises and supporting the process of living with the impacts of traumatic events, generational and complex trauma and post traumatic stress (PTSD). I have significant experience offering services to survivors of residential schools, adults and youth with experiences of severe mental illness and addiction, as well as individuals, families and communities living with the effects of systemic violence, marginalization and stigma. My practice is grounded in the principles of Recovery, Harm Reduction and Social Justice.

Ways we can WORK TOGETHER…

I have certifications and training in a number of therapeutic modalities, which I integrate to create a unique therapeutic engagement that tailors to the needs of the person (or people) I’m working with. I commonly utilize approaches from Cognitive Behavioural (CBT), Dialectical Behavioural (DBT), Narrative, Emotion Focused (EFIT, EFFT), Eye Movement, Desensitization and Reprocessing (EMDR), Somatic and Play Therapies. My training as a yoga instructor gives us the option to incorporate mindful movement, breath work and techniques in relaxation and mental focus into our work together.

If possible, we can incorporate nature into the therapeutic process. This can mean going for a walk (walk-and-talk) or finding a quiet bench in a park to sit and chat. With (not just) kids, this can mean exploring the nature through play. Integral to this experience is the awareness of self in connection to nature, where the self is simply “being,” observing, or participating in (influencing and being influenced by) the natural environment.

I view any therapeutic approach as a means of gaining new insights and opening up possibilities for alternative ways of being and engaging with our lives. I view the therapeutic relationship and the space of trust we create between us as the medium of change.
